The US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) has issued an order filing and simultaneously settling charges against Singapore-based Olam International and Olam Americas. Olam operates a futures trading desk in London, England, and its subsidiary, Olam Americas, Inc. (Olam Americas), which is based in Summit, New Jersey, operates a futures trading desk there. Both companies purchase, sell, and trade cocoa and other agricultural products. The CFTC Order requires Olam International and Olam Americas to pay a USD3 million civil monetary penalty and prohibits them from committing future violations of the Commodity Exchange Act (CEA) and CFTC Regulations, as charged. Houlihan Lokey, has appointed Patrick Collins as managing director in the firm’s Financial Sponsors Group based in New York.  Collins will primarily focus on assisting the firm's hedge fund and financial sponsor clients with distressed and special situations investment opportunities. Collins joins Houlihan Lokey from Collins Investments LLC, the investment firm he founded in 2008, where he managed private equity and debt investments in small- and mid-cap companies. Convergex, an agency-focused global brokerage and trading related services provider, has added two industry veterans to its international leadership team.  Philip Gough has joined the firm as chief executive officer of Convergex Limited, Convergex’s London-based brokerage. Gough will oversee all aspects of Convergex’s international business operations and will serve on the firm’s Executive Committee. In addition, John Holl has joined the company as managing director and head of Convergex Limited’s sales and trading. MIK Fund Solutions, a provider of decision support software solutions for alternative asset managers, has expanded its geographic footprint into Asia, basing its APAC headquarters in Shanghai, China.  This is the latest in a series of strategic initiatives by MIK. The new office serves as a core piece of the foundation for the implementation of MIK’s 24 x7 global delivery model for software development and client support. MIK has resourced the expansion with a staff of 9. FxPro Financial Services Limited (‘FxPro’) has launched a Prime-of-Prime service in a bid to attract institutional investors and enable them to benefit from greater transparency and trading cost efficiencies.
